Research and application of distributed OSGi for cloud computing

7Citations
Citations of this article
27Readers
Mendeley users who have this article in their library.
Get full text

Abstract

With Java runtime-based application has been widely used in our enterprise application and mobile computing.We must maintain many machines in different types, like web server cluster,distributed database,virtual machines,hosting machines and so on.Cloud computing technology has been designed to manage those resources in efficiently way. Client agent can be installed in those host machines or virtual environment to monitor machine status.But with the size expand of the cloud domain,those client agents should be updated or reinstalled. OSGi is an industry standard for a lean Java-based component system with focusing on service-oriented architecture.In this issue,we present OSGi for the cloud computing environment allowing seamless deployment and update function in dynamic way.After use OSGi as the architecture foundation of client agent we use an underlying peer-to-peer infrastructure to provide,share and load OSGi bundles at runtime.Cloud computing bundles on-line warehouse has been established to support bundle download and on-line update.OSGi based on client agent can communication with cloud computing management system to monitor and manage cloud resource in real time. ©2010 IEEE.

Cite

CITATION STYLE

APA

Hang, C., & Can, C. (2010). Research and application of distributed OSGi for cloud computing. In 2010 International Conference on Computational Intelligence and Software Engineering, CiSE 2010. https://doi.org/10.1109/CISE.2010.5676965

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free